Objective Structured Practical Examination (OSPE) and mock licensing exams

OSPE, and mock licensing exams are offered by ZSMU at the AMA-ZSMU Medical Campus (OSPE assesses practical skills, knowledge and/or interpretation of data in non-clinical settings).  
The objective structured clinical examinations are widely used in health sciences to practically assess skills and competencies in a realistic clinical setting. The OSCEs are very helpful in medical education because they allow a student to practice and demonstrate clinical skills in a standardized medical scenario. Students have the opportunity to demonstrate competency in communication, history taking, physical examination, clinical reasoning, medical knowledge, and integration of these skills. It is meant to be a fair and accurate way to assess competence, as well as identify areas that need more work and practice.

AMA-ZSMU Medical Campus OSCE stations include

  • Clinical interactions (in-person or virtual) with standardized patients: counseling, examination, history taking
  • Examination of mannequins and interpretation of findings
  • Computerized cases
  • Test Interpretation
  • Order writing

As often the OSCE would be part of the licensing examination process of various national medical boards. We make sure AMA-ZSMU Medical Campus students are well prepared for these evaluations by practicing in clinical skills simulation rooms with actor patients, offering mock OSCE exams and a number of student-administered free practice rooms that are adequately equipped.
